Triumph Tiger 1050 Sport (2013)
The 2013 Triumph Tiger 1050 Sport is a motorcycle with a four-stroke, transverse three-cylinder engine capable of 1050cc. The motorcycle utilizes a liquid cooling system and has a compression ratio of 12.0:1. The engine uses synthetic 10W/40 oil and features a stainless steel 3-into-1 exhaust system. The ignition is digital and spark plugs are NGK, DPR8EA-9. The bike produces a maximum power output of 123 horsepower at 9400 rpm and has a maximum torque of 77 ft-lb at 430 rpm. The transmission is six-speed and the final drive is an x-ring chain. The aluminum beam perimeter frame has a swingarm made of single-sided aluminum alloy. The front suspension is 43mm Showa upside-down forks with adjustable preload, rebound, and compression damping. The rear suspension is a Showa Mono-shock with adjustable preload and rebound damping. The bike has two front brakes with 320mm discs and four-piston calipers, and a single rear brake with a 255mm disc and two-piston caliper. The front tire is a 120/70 ZR17 and the rear tire is a 180/55 ZR17. The instrument pack is an LCD multi-functional display. The motorcycle has a length of 2150mm, a width of 835mm, a height without mirrors of 1310mm, and a wheelbase of 1540mm. The wet weight of the bike is 235kg and the fuel capacity is 20 liters.
Technical specifications:
Make Model: Triumph Tiger 1050 Sport
Year: 2013
Engine: Four stroke, transverse three cylinder, DOHC, 4 valves per cylinder.
Capacity: 1050 cc / 64.1 cu in
Bore x Stroke: 79 x 71.4mm
Cooling System: Liquid cooled
Compression Ratio: 12.0:1
Lubrication: Wet sump
Oil Capacity: 3.5 Litres/ 0.9 US gals / 0.77 Imp gal
Engine Oil: Synthetic, 10W/40
Exhaust: Stainless Steel 3 into 1, high level brushed stainless steel silencer
Induction: Multipoint sequential electronic fuel injection
Ignition: Digital
Spark Plug: NGK, DPR8EA-9
Starting: Electric
Max Power: 91.7 kW / 123 hp @ 9400 rpm
Max Torque: 104.3 Nm / 10.63 kgf-m / 77 ft-lb @ 430 rpm
Clutch: Wet, multi-plate
Transmission: 6 Speed
Final Drive: X ring chain
Frame: Aluminum beam perimeter, swingarm: braced, single-sided, aluminum alloy
Front Suspension: 43mm Showa upside down forks with adjustable preload, rebound and compression damping adjustment
Front Wheel Travel: 140 mm / 5.5 in
Rear Suspension: Showa Mono-shock with adjustable preload and rebound damping,
Rear Wheel Travel: 150 mm / 5.9 in
Front Brakes: 2x 320 mm Discs, 4 piston calipers
Rear Brakes: Single 255 mm disc, 2 piston caliper
Wheel Front: Cast aluminium alloy, 17 x 3.5in
Wheel Rear: Cast aluminium alloy, 17 x 5.5in
Front Tyre: 120/70 ZR17
Rear Tyre: 180/55 ZR17
Rake: 22.8 degrees
Trail: 89.7mm / 3.5 in
Dimensions: Length 2150 mm / 84.6 in Width (handlebars) 835 mm / 32.8 in) Height without mirrors 1310 mm / 51.5 in
Wheelbase: 1540mm / 60.6in
Seat Height: 830mm / 32.7in
Wet Weight: 235kg / 517 lbs
Fuel Capacity: 20 Litres / 5.3 US gal / 4.4 Imp gal
Instrument: LCD multi-functional instrument pack
